Delbert Wilbert Black was born on October 22, 1931 in Pleasant Mound Township to Wilbert and Cora (Stolzman) Black. He was baptized and confirmed at St. John's Lutheran Church-Willow Creek. Delbert attended parochial school at St. John's Lutheran Church-Willow Creek. He was an active member of St. John's Lutheran Church and held numerous offices throughout the years. He served in the US Army from 1953-1955. On January 10, 1954 Delbert was united in marriage to Darlene Jahnz. They farmed for many years in the Willow Creek area. After retiring he continued to help his son with spring and fall work. He enjoyed growing watermelons which he gave to his family, friends, the Salvation Army and Echo Food Shelf. His hobbies included fishing, hunting, golfing, playing cards with friends and spending time with his kids, grandkids and great grandkids. Delbert died on Saturday, August 28, 2010 at St. Mary's Hospital in Rochester.
